Posted by: @iancalderbank@toodles charge rate one of the best bits about powerwall, part of why I went for it over others. 5kw PER powerwall. I have 3 so can (and do) pull 15kw to grid charge them during off-peak. and that is enough to supply any sane house load peak (I've broken through 10kw briefly with everything on).
to show how you can make best use of them with the heat pump: Yesterday evening from 9pm to 1130pm was the first time I've had to buy any on-peak electricity at all since I went to a fully electric house in march last year. heat pump COP dropped due to it being brass-monkey weather , sub zero morning, and zero sun where we are.
